Biology and Appearance

Sanyassans are a humanoid species with reptilian traits. Members of the species had powerfully-built frames and grow tall, between 1.6 and 2.5 meters. Sanyassans have greasy, thick strands of hair, usually pale, sometimes dark, sprouting from the crown of their flat heads, occasionally from the skin on their faces. Heavy protective brow ridges thrust like hoods over glittering eyes; pug nose-holes give the marauders a skull-like appearance. Sexual dimorphism manifested predominantly in the presence of pronounced breasts in females. Sanyassan women also tended to have smoother skin and did not grow facial hair.

Society and Culture

Sanyassan society are divided into clanic structures—united groups of households tracing descent from a common ancestor. There existed a form of aristocracy, but social standing was gained by force, rather than birthright. Their culture is brutal, based on warfare and exploitation of the weak. The species seemed unforgiving, ruthless and calculating to outsiders. In the wider galaxy, these fierce brawlers were renowned for their bad tempers and low intellectual performance. Despite their aggressive nature, the Sanyassans were social beings and did not feel comfortable while alone. They preferred to be in large groups, as when marching out to raid. Technologically primitive by galactic standards, Sanyassans formed a feudal-level civilization, with a crude hieroglyphic writing system. They never developed the secrets of space travel for themselves, but stole it from others and they rely on poor instinctive piloting skills when piloting stolen ships. They had a rather rudimentary grasp on technology. Despite their poor intelligence, most Sanyassans could speak a broken form of Galactic Basic Standard, in addition to their native Sanyassan.






















Names

Sanyassan names are generally short, between two and three syllables. They lack surnames or familial names.

Male Names. Terak, Bar'injar, Maygo, Yavid

Female Names. Krenna, Terakaya

Sanyassan Traits

As an Sanyassan, you have the following special traits.

Ability Score Increase. Your Charisma score increases by 2, and your Strength score increases by 1.

Age. Sanyassans reach adulthood in their early teens and live about 70 years, though some live to be over 100.

Alignment. Sanyassan culture glorifies violence and warfare, causing most to tend toward the dark side, though there are exceptions.

Size. Sanyassans typically stand between 5 and 6 feet tall and weigh 150 lbs. Regardless of your position in that range, your size is Medium.

Speed. Your base walking speed is 30 feet.

Menacing. You have proficiency in the Intimidation skill.

Toughness. Your hit point maximum increases by 1, and it increases by 1 every time you gain a level.

Aggressive. As a bonus action, you can move up to your speed toward an enemy of your choice that you can see or hear. You must end this move closer to the enemy than you started.

Savage Attacks. When you score a critical hit with a melee weapon attack, you can roll one of the weapon’s damage dice one additional time and add it to the extra damage of the critical hit.

Crude Armor Specialists. Sanyassans have have a primitive technological culture, but are adept in scavenging materials to make their own armor. You can spend 1 hour, which you can do over the course of a short rest, crafting a set of armor out of loose materials. The armor acts as Fiber Armor (AC 12+Dex), but has the "Bulky" property.

Languages. You can speak Galactic Basic and Sanyassan, but can only read and write in Sanyassan. Sanyassan features growls, guttural snarls, and shrieks.
